Major Infrastructure Upgrades Transforming Lansing
One of the most talked-about developments in Wilx News Lansing this year is the ongoing expansion of the Grand River Avenue corridor. City officials announced major road resurfacing and smart traffic signal installations aimed at reducing congestion during peak hours. These upgrades, part of a $45 million investment, are expected to cut average commute times by 20% over the next two years. Residents along GR Avenue report noticeable improvements in morning and evening travel, highlighting the practical impact of data-driven urban planning.

Public Safety and Civic Engagement in Focus
Public safety remains a top priority in Wilx News Lansing coverage. Recent reports detail enhanced collaboration between local law enforcement and community groups to address neighborhood concerns. A new neighborhood watch program, launched in spring, has already seen participation from over 300 residents. Combined with increased patrol visibility, these efforts have contributed to a 12% drop in reported incidents in pilot areas. This model of partnership strengthens trust and demonstrates effective, people-centered policing.
